HomeMy WebLinkAboutMINUTES - 01082013 - C.73RECOMMENDATION(S):
Approve and authorize the Health Services Director, or his designee, to execute, on behalf of the County, Standard
Agreement (Amendment) #29-764-21 (State #03MR003, A11) with the State of California, Managed Risk Medical
Insurance Board, effective January 1, 2013, to amend Standard Agreement #29-764-9 (as amended by Amendment
Agreements #29-764-10 through #29-764-20), to increase the amount paid to County by $246,148, from $2,705,616,
to a new total payment of $2,951,764 and extend the term from December 31, 2012 through December 31, 2013.
FISCAL IMPACT:
Approval of this Standard Agreement (Amendment) will result in an increase of $246,148 of State funding for the
Major Risk Medical Insurance Program. No County match is required.
